Built in 1840, for sale for the first time in nearly 30 years, this 21' - 8” wide Greek Revival townhome sits perfectly on one of the Gold Coast's most coveted tree-lined townhouse blocks. Flanked by picturesque townhomes on both sides, #40 offers four renovated stories plus a cellar set on a lot nearly 95' deep with a Southern facing garden. The location simply cannot be rivaled, as West 11th Street between 5th and 6th Avenues is one of the few Greenwich Village blocks to have retained its history and protected a contiguous line of 21 houses, avoiding high-rise development. Structurally sound, the house has been perfectly maintained since its renovation in 1993. Elegant single family house with enchanting rear Carriage house and elevator.Built in 1831 and completely remodeled in 1925 in the Georgian Palladian style. While houses of this period are known for their dignified, symmetrical and highly ornamented features, this splendid 22' wide house is also distinctly relaxed and inviting. There are wonderful entertaining rooms; the front drawing room has full length arched windows overlooking this quiet Village Street; there is a distinguished wood paneled library; and a stunning dining room which opens onto a romantic walled garden and an incredibly rare English styled cottage at the rear of the property.In addition to the entertaining rooms, the main house has 4 large bedrooms and four and a half baths, six wood burning fireplaces and an Otis elevator. The cottage has a sky lit studio with a fireplace, a sleeping loft and a full bath.This welcoming house has had a remarkable history and many of its owners have been great patrons and philanthropists. In 1907 Clara Davidge, owned the house. She was a painter who was very interested in all the arts. She adored the poet Edwin Arlington Robinson and wanting to find an inspirational place for him to write, built the private carriage house as a sanctuary. It was here that Robinson compiled his "The Town Down the River", published in 1910. For many decades the rear cottage was home and studio to many artists. At one point in the 1920's even the front house became studios to artists of the day.A later resident Francis Perkins went on to become the first female appointed to the United States Cabinet, serving as U.S. Secretary of Labor under Franklin D. Roosevelt. The house has been a gathering place of many artists, literary figures, musicians and luminaries including Willa Cather, Samuel Clemens, Gertrude Vanderbilt Whitney, and in more recent times Patti Smith, Allen Ginsberg, Muhammad Ali, Steve Earle, Rosalynn and Jimmy Carter and Hillary Clinton.
